The Kiss my Face spray (#6) is our favorite, especially for reapplying. I usually try to use one of the heavier zinc ones for first application in the morning but trying to reapply on a squirming and often wet or sweaty toddler is a challenge. The Kiss my Face spray is a bit thinner so it rubs in easily and the spray makes it super easy and fast.

FYI the Kiss My Face spray is different than the other lotions and has chemical block. The one on the EWG list is different than what is posted here.
